## What is the Capacity of Blockspace Utilization?

Blockspace utilization, within cryptocurrency networks, quantifies the proportion of available blockspace consumed by transactions or data. It represents a critical metric for assessing network congestion and the efficiency of resource allocation. Higher utilization rates can indicate increased demand and potentially lead to elevated transaction fees, impacting overall network usability and scalability. Understanding this metric is essential for optimizing trading strategies involving on-chain assets and for evaluating the long-term viability of various blockchain architectures.

## What is the Cost of Blockspace Utilization?

Ultimately, blockspace utilization directly influences the cost of transacting on a blockchain or executing trades within a derivatives market. Increased demand, reflected in higher utilization, typically drives up fees or spreads as participants compete for limited resources. This dynamic necessitates careful consideration of transaction costs when designing trading strategies and managing risk exposure, particularly in volatile market conditions. Efficient resource management and strategic timing become crucial for minimizing expenses and maximizing returns.
